With well over 50,000 inhabitants, Passau is the second-largest city in Lower Bavaria after Landshut and is also home to the only university in the administrative district. Located at the confluence of the Danube, Ilz and Inn rivers, the city has a large student population (regularly just under 12,000), while at the same time more than 40 percent of residents are over 50 years of age and therefore exposed to a particular risk: fraudsters in particular like to target older victims – keyword: the “grandchild scam”. Often referred to as the “Venice of Bavaria” because of its Mediterranean-style architecture, Passau is not only a tourism hub due to its ideal location for river cruises: in 2022 alone, 247,360 tourists from Germany and abroad visited the Passau peninsula, not including day visitors and cruise passengers; before the pandemic, the figures were significantly higher.
